Android Workshop

"Once a new technology rolls over you, if you’re not part of the steamroller, you’re part of the road."

–Stewart Brand

Trying to live by the wise words of Mr.Brand , we from IEEE-VESIT are pleased to inform you that we are back with a chance to be on the steamroller with the duly anticipated 'Android Workshop with Firebase'.

So, Come, learn and apply.

Flow of the Workshop :

Day 1 : A basic Introduction to Android Studio and Firebase, with more emphasis on the latter. Exploring the various aspects of configuring Firebase,a NoSQL database platform used widely in Mobile/Web applications for real time updation of Database on the cloud. Main focus will be on Authorization using Firebase and Google Accounts.

Day 2 : Applying the knowledge of Day 1 to create a Notes App, by using the previously created database and authorization on Firebase, and Android Studio for the frontend.

Prerequisites of your laptop :

4 GB of recommended available disk space.
3 GB RAM minimum, 8GB recommend.
64 bit models, capable of running 32 bit applications.
Android Studio and JDK has to be installed in your laptop before sitting for the workshop.
